Keeping up with the changing nature of social networks and microblogging, Twitter has updated both their Android and iOS apps today introducing a whole new look and feel as well as introducing some nifty features such as sending and receiving pictures in DMs and swipeable tabs available from the feed.
DMs can now be easily accessed via a bar at the bottom of the screen, with the top bar becoming swipeable with access to Home, Activity and Discover areas. Searching is easier than ever, with quick access to tweets from people nearby or from a quick search. iOS users can now save web articles to read later with Safari Reading List.
